When I'm mobile I just use a little glass bottle that I got some monomer in from Ezflow.
I just top the bottle up when it's needed, the lid screws on so it doesn't leak. It gives me the extra monomer "just in case".
I also have a dappen dish with a cork (also from Ezflow) that never leaks but I am always careful when I'm driving that I don't turn my beautybox over. I keep it upright in the well of the front passenger seat and it works ok for me.
